CBIZ, Inc. (CBZ) statistics: revenue, profit & scale

The headline figures, each with its date. Every row carries its own link — cite it straight from here.

  • CBIZ, Inc. has a market value of $3.0B and an enterprise value of $4.8B.

  • Revenue in the twelve months to 30 June 2026: $2.8B. The latest quarter shrank 0.2% year on year.

  • Net income over the same four quarters: $130.9M, a 4.7% net margin.

  • Diluted earnings per share, trailing twelve months: $1.96.

  • Free cash flow in the twelve months to 30 June 2026: $274.3M.

  • CBIZ, Inc. spent $159.0M on share buybacks in the twelve months to 30 June 2026.

  • Shares outstanding: 54.0M.

  • Trailing P/E: 26.3×; forward P/E: 12.9× — the forward figure prices analyst consensus estimates, not reported earnings.

  • Forward dividend yield: 0.37%, paying out 0% of earnings.

  • CBIZ, Inc. employs 9,500 people $291K of revenue per employee.

What is the CBZ stock forecast for 2030?

No analyst covering CBIZ, Inc. publishes a 2030 price target — Wall Street targets run 12 to 18 months out. Sites quoting a 2030 price for CBZ are extrapolating price history, which says nothing about the business. The furthest attributed numbers are the current analyst targets: $45 to $55 over the next 12 months.

About CBIZ, Inc.

CBIZ, Inc. is a professional services company that provides accounting, tax, advisory, benefits, insurance, payroll, and technology solutions to businesses and organizations. It serves small and middle-market clients, as well as individuals, governmental entities, and not-for-profit groups, through its Financial Services, Benefits and Insurance Services, and National Practices segments. CBIZ’s offerings include financial and risk consulting, employee benefits consulting, human capital management, property and casualty insurance, retirement and investment services, and managed networking and hardware support. The company focuses on helping clients manage core business operations, regulatory requirements, workforce needs, and technology infrastructure. Headquartered in Independence, Ohio, CBIZ operates across the United States and Canada, positioning itself as a broad professional services provider for organizations seeking integrated financial and operational support.
